4 Maintenance of discipline and order

  Maintenance of security, discipline, and order in penal institutions is fundamental to ensure effective treatment.
  Punishments can be imposed on inmates who have not followed the ordinary or special conditions specified by the wardens of penal institutions or instructions for maintaining discipline and order provided by officials. In 2008, disciplinary punishments were imposed on a total of 69,044 inmates. The most common reason for punishment was neglect of work duty (refers to neglect of work without due reason; 24.9%) and inappropriate giving and receiving of gifts (7.1%) (Source: Annual Report of Statistics on Correction).
  Table 2-4-2-1 shows the number of incidents that occurred in penal institutions in 2008 including escapes, homicide, and injury, etc.
